Output 29c326dd58d911220686b6505fb2bdcb87cf2bfa56fdbfee096c4e4daaa723aa:2

value
10172678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24b8537c88aeaa2e4f8b730a450ee11bea046bf0 OP_EQUAL
address
MBFKNYEeRRZKBqGp83MKJAp6aXvain9Gzj
transaction
29c326dd58d911220686b6505fb2bdcb87cf2bfa56fdbfee096c4e4daaa723aa
spent
true